Abstract: This project introduces an IoT-based Off-Highway Vehicle Management System (OHVMS) utilizing the J1939 protocol. The system aims to enhance operational efficiency and safety by monitoring engine parameters in real-time. Through IoT devices and sensors, engine data such as temperature, pressure, RPM, and fuel consumption are collected and transmitted to a centralized server. Key features include remote monitoring, fault detection, and predictive maintenance. By leveraging the J1939 protocol, the OHVMS offers standardized communication for improved performance and maintenance of off-highway vehicles.
